素早く問題を解いてInput⇔Outputを繰り返し!
会員レベル
ログイン
メンバーシップアカウント
会員レベル
ログイン
メンバーシップアカウント
HOME
Shopify Partner Theme Development
「Shopify Partner Theme Development」の記事一覧
ShopifyのAjax APIを使用して、ページ遷移なしでカートの商品数を取得するエンドポイントはどれか。
/cart.jsonにGETリクエストを送ることで、現在のカート内容をJSON形式で取得できる。
2026年3月23日
現在のページが「商品詳細ページ」であるかを判定するLiquidの条件式はどれか。
request.page_typeを使用することで、テンプレート名に左右されずページの種類を判定できる。
2026年3月23日
Liquidで画像のサイズを指定して取得する正しい書き方はどれか。
image_urlフィルターの引数にwidthを指定して適切なサイズの画像を取得する。
2026年3月23日
forループ内で現在のループが何回目か(1から開始)を取得するプロパティはどれか。
forloop.indexは現在のループ回数を1からカウントした値を返す。
2026年3月23日
別のLiquidファイルを読み込む際、変数をカプセル化(スコープを限定)して呼び出すタグはどれか。
renderタグはincludeタグと異なり、明示的に渡さない限り親の変数にアクセスできない。
2026年3月23日
テーマエディタ上でセクションのプレビュー名を変更するために、schema内で指定するプロパティはどれか。
schema内のnameプロパティがエディタ上の表示名となる。
2026年3月23日
セクション内で繰り返しの要素(例:スライドショーの各画像)を定義するために使用するスキーマの項目はどれか。
blocksを使用することで、セクション内に複数の子要素を追加・並べ替え可能にできる。
2026年3月23日
Shopify管理画面で定義したカスタムデータをLiquidで呼び出す際に経由するオブジェクトはどれか。
メタフィールドには各オブジェクトのmetafieldsプロパティからアクセスする。
2026年3月23日
Liquidのif文において、「等しくない」を意味する演算子はどれか。
等しくないことを判定するには演算子!=を使用する。
2026年3月23日
特定のコレクションに含まれる商品一覧を取得するためにループ処理する対象はどれか。
collection.productsを使用してコレクション内の商品リストを反復処理する。
2026年3月23日
投稿のページ送り
1
…
97
98
99
…
248